原文:v-for设置键值 key

总是用 key 配合 v for。在组件上 总是 必须用 key 配合 v for,以便维护内部组件及其子树的状态。 ...

2018-08-21 18:40 0 987 推荐指数:

查看详情

Vue v-forkey值如何设置

Vue-for的key值到怎么设置? 在Vue项目中,v-for所在的DOM上,如果不设置key值,编辑器会警告;如果开启了eslint,eslint检查会提示需要给v-for设置key值 。我在做代码CR时,发现很多同学喜欢设置key值为唯一标识,像以下代码第二行设置为item.id ...

Fri Jul 30 20:06:00 CST 2021 0 400
v-for 为什么必须使用key

vue 之前的版本没有限制 v-for 中配置 key 现在需要配置不然会报错 为什么 必须使用key 因为vue组件高度复用,增加Key可以标识组件的唯一性,key的作用主要是为了高效的更新虚拟DOM,后续再原理给大家讲解 如何正确使用key VUE 使用v-for更新已渲染的元素列表时 ...

Mon Mar 02 23:34:00 CST 2020 0 1168
关于vue中v-for键值顺序

在学习vue2.0时,关于处理v-for键值顺序时发现的问题: 不管是用 <li v-for = "(value,name) in user">{{name}}-{{value}}</li> 还是说 ...

Wed Oct 09 16:57:00 CST 2019 0 930
vue的就地复用--- v-for与:key

的场景【比如form表单或者重新排序等】中,就可能会报错,最好在v-for的同时设置key参数。 因为v ...

Wed Oct 23 22:20:00 CST 2019 0 414
v-forkey的作用

key的作用主要是为了更高效的对比虚拟DOM中每个节点是否是相同节点; Vue在patch过程中判断两个节点是否是相同节点,key是一个必要条件,渲染一组列表时,key往往是唯一标识,所以如果不定义key的话,Vue只能认为比较的两个节点是同一个,哪怕它们实际上不是,这导致了频繁更新 ...

Mon Nov 01 22:20:00 CST 2021 0 1787
v-for中为什么加key

vue中列表循环需加:key="唯一标识" 唯一标识可以是item里面id index等,因为vue组件高度复用增加Key可以标识组件的唯一性,为了更好地区别各个组件 key的作用主要是为了高效的更新虚拟DOM v-for中:key的作用总结 key可用来唯一标识组件元素 ...

Thu May 20 23:47:00 CST 2021 0 965
v-for为什么要加key,能用index作为key

前言 在vue中使用v-for时,一直有几个疑问: v-for为什么要加key 为什么有时候用index作为key会出错 带着这个疑问,结合各种博客和源码,终于有了点眉目。 virtual dom 要理解diff的过程,先要对virtual dom有个了解,这里简单介绍下 ...

Fri Aug 09 22:41:00 CST 2019 1 2825
vue中v-for索引不要用key

今天发现在给元素v-for渲染的时候,想给元素添加key特性存储索引,发现不奏效: key特性在渲染后是不出现的。 将key改为其他自定义名称即可,比如: ...

Sat Aug 26 19:52:00 CST 2017 0 1177
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M